SUMMARY/OBJECTIVE
The Engineer II, Corporate IT is responsible for supporting internal and remote users. Responsibilities include installation, upgrading, and troubleshooting of hardware and software, maintaining inventory of company assets, account management through Active Directory, Office 365 and other administrative portals as well as handling all physical moves of employees’ workstations.
The Engineer II, Corporate IT is responsible for executing assigned tasks per team leads and management while also conducting process and procedure review for Engineer I team members. Additionally, they must manage tasks and updates via GlobalTranz tools (I.e. Zendesk, Jira, etc)
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
  • Provide troubleshooting for hardware and software issues utilizing a service desk ticketing system with additional communication happening via email, IM/chat, in-person and phone calls
  • Assessing and troubleshooting issues on hardware/software, matching incidents against known problems and errors, then providing a solution or workaround to customers
  • Escalating incidents appropriately as needed when a solution is not easily solvable
  • Properly documenting incidents in the ticketing system and updating support tools appropriately
  • Build and prepare desktop and laptop PC’s using company standard development tools and processes
  • Aid security team in maintaining and implementing security initiatives
  • Create and manage user accounts in Active Directory, Office 365 and other online admin consoles
  • Provide troubleshooting and maintenance for VoIP phones, printers, scanners, and mobile devices
  • Provide phone and screen share support to remote employees and outside sales agents
  • Assist with documenting and maintaining SOPs, as necessary
  • Assist on departmental and business wide technology projects when needed
  • Support teams via guidance and training
  • Perform physical moves of user equipment when needed
